White Out @ The Phillips Collection

On Thursday, the snowpocalypse was relived. The End of Summer White Party thrown by the Pink Line Project took over the Phillips Collection, a last hooray for summer.

The theme was the now iconic snowpocalypse, fitting well with the minimalism seen in the Phillips Collection’s two current exhibitions; Robert Ryman: Variations and Improvisations and Pousette-Dart: Predominantly White Paintings.

The End of Summer White Party featured interactive art by Kenny George and Alberto Gaitan, music by BLUEBRAIN and dancing by Glade Dance Collective. Event goers sipped on wine (white, of course) while enjoying the cooler weather. While not everyone wore white, there was an impressive effort (especially at a post-work event).
